This opening marks the first of three locations that franchisees Matt McKinney and Allison McKinney will open in the Tyler market and the second franchise location in Texas, joining the Einstein Bros Bagels in Frisco.
The new restaurant is the fifth Einstein Bros franchise location for the brand's parent company, Einstein Noah Restaurant Group.
In addition to the McKinneys three-unit deal, Einstein Noah Restaurant Group has inked 10 other multi-unit franchise agreements to open locations in Jacksonville, Florida, Orange County, California, Northwest Arkansas, Augusta, Georgia, Colorado, Utah and multiple markets throughout Texas.
Jeff O'Neill, CEO and president of Einstein Noah Restaurant Group, said: "We are extremely pleased with the growth of our franchising program for the Einstein Bros brand. We believe that continued expansion by aggressive growth-minded franchisees like the McKinneys is a sign that the Einstein Bros Bagels brand is a high quality investment, and that we are one step closer to achieving our vision of becoming the fastest growing fast casual restaurant chain in North America."
